#78c8a8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#78c8a8 is composed of 47.1% red, 78.4% green and 65.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40% cyan, 0% magenta, 16%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 156 degrees, a saturation of 42.1% and a lightness of 62.7%. #78c8a8 color hex could be obtained by blending #f0ffff with #009151.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

Shades and Tints of #78c8a8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020403 is the darkest color, while #f5fbf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#78c8a8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9da3a1 is the less saturated color, while #45fbb2 is the most saturated one.
